Class DecimalNumberingSystem

    • Constructor Summary

      Constructors 
      Constructor Description
      DecimalNumberingSystem​(java.lang.String name, java.lang.String[] digits, java.util.Map<NumberSymbolType,​java.lang.String> symbols, int minimumGroupingDigits, int primaryGroupingSize, int secondaryGroupingSize)  
    • Method Summary

      All Methods Static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      static java.lang.String fastFormatDecimal​(java.lang.String n, java.lang.String[] digits, int minInt)  
      protected java.lang.String formatDecimal​(Decimal n, boolean groupDigits, int minInt)  
      java.lang.String formatString​(long n, boolean groupDigits, int minInt)  
      java.lang.String formatString​(Decimal n, boolean groupDigits, int minInt)  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• DecimalNumberingSystem

        public DecimalNumberingSystem​(java.lang.String name,
                                      java.lang.String[] digits,
                                      java.util.Map<NumberSymbolType,​java.lang.String> symbols,
                                      int minimumGroupingDigits,
                                      int primaryGroupingSize,
                                      int secondaryGroupingSize)
    • Method Detail

      • formatString

        public java.lang.String formatString​(long n,
                                             boolean groupDigits,
                                             int minInt)
        Specified by:
        formatString in class NumberingSystem
      • formatDecimal

        protected java.lang.String formatDecimal​(Decimal n,
                                                 boolean groupDigits,
                                                 int minInt)
      • fastFormatDecimal

        public static java.lang.String fastFormatDecimal​(java.lang.String n,
                                                         java.lang.String[] digits,
                                                         int minInt)